When there is no PCI bus uclass_first_device will return no bus and no
error which will result in pci_find_first_device calling
skip_to_next_device with no bus, and the bus is only checked at the end
of the while cycle, not the beginning.

Also stop dealing with the return value of
uclass_first_device/uclass_next_device - once the iteration is fixed to
continue after an error there is nothing meaningful to get anymore.

Fixes: 76c3fbcd3d ("dm: pci: Add a way to iterate through all PCI devices")
